The earliest that you can plant polygonums in Porterville is March. However, you really should wait until April if you don't want to take any chances.

The last month that you can plant polygonums and expect a good harvest is probably September. If you wait any later than that and your polygonums may not have a chance to really do well. Starting your polygonums indoors is a great way to get them started a little bit earlier.

Last Frost Date

In Porterville the average date of last frost happens on February 15. You should expect an average low temperature of 25°F in the coldest months of winter.

Keep in mind that USDA zone info for Porterville is just an average and the actual date of last frost will vary from year to year. Half of the time in Porterville you get surprised by a frost after February 15 so make sure that you are ready to protect your polygonums in the event of one of those late frosts.
